    list box coding question

    Hi there,

    I have a quick question regarding populating a list or combo box based on
    certain criteria from another combo box. (if this is at all possible with
    excel..hehe). What I am looking for is the following:

    On one sheet I have a combo box. On the same sheet I would like to have
    another list or combo that populates itself with specific Cells from another
    sheet. The tricky part is how would i get the criteria aspect working? I
    figure it will have to be with VBA code, but even then how? If the first
    combo box has the word Clients, then the second combo box would only show
    the list of Client names (located on a different sheet within the same
    workbook).

    Any help, or at least a point in the right direction, is most appreciated.
